如果你是 VS Code 用户,大概率已经听说过 Cline。这款 AI 编程插件凭借出色的自主编码能力和灵活的模型接入方式,已经积累了超过 500 万次安装,成为 VS Code 生态中最受欢迎的 AI 辅助编程工具之一。
然而,很多开发者在使用 Cline 时会遇到一个问题:默认的 API 提供商要么需要海外信用卡,要么价格偏高,要么国内访问不稳定。本文将详细介绍如何通过配置第三方 API(以 OpenStarry 为例),让 Cline 在国内环境下也能流畅使用。
Cline 简介:为什么它值得关注
核心数据
- 版本:v3.83(截至 2026 年 5 月)
- 安装量:500 万+(VS Code Marketplace)
- GitHub Stars:61,000+
- 定位:自主 AI 编程助手,能独立完成从需求理解到代码实现的完整流程
与 Cursor 的区别
Cursor 是一个独立的 IDE,需要单独安装和配置。而 Cline 是一个 VS Code 插件,直接在你已有的 VS Code 环境中运行。这意味着:
- 零迁移成本:你的所有 VS Code 配置、主题、快捷键都可以保留
- 插件生态兼容:Cline 可以和你已安装的其他 VS Code 插件协同工作
- API 自由选择:不像 Cursor 有内置的 API 绑定,Cline 支持完全自定义 API 提供商
核心能力
Cline 不是简单的代码补全工具。它能够:
- 阅读和理解整个项目的代码结构
- 创建和修改文件,执行终端命令
- 在浏览器中测试和调试应用
- 通过 MCP(Model Context Protocol)连接外部工具和数据源
- 根据自然语言描述自主完成复杂的开发任务
v3.2 智能模型路由:自动选择最省钱的模型
Cline 在 v3.2 版本引入了一项重要功能——智能模型路由(Intelligent Model Routing)。这项功能能够根据任务的复杂度,自动选择最合适(也是最经济)的模型。
工作原理
- Cline 分析当前任务的复杂度(简单文件操作 vs 复杂架构设计)
- 根据预设策略,自动选择最适合的模型层级
- 简单任务使用便宜的模型(如 DeepSeek V4-Flash),复杂任务使用强力模型(如 Claude Sonnet)
实际成本效果
根据社区用户的反馈,开启智能路由后,典型的月度 API 费用在 $8-12 之间。相比全程使用 Claude Sonnet(月费可能超过 $50),成本降低了 75% 以上。
提示:智能路由功能需要你的 API 提供商同时支持多个模型。OpenStarry 通过一个 API Key 提供 40+ 模型,是搭配 Cline 智能路由的理想选择。
配置步骤:5 分钟接入 OpenStarry
前置准备
- 已安装 VS Code(v1.95 或更高版本)
- 已安装 Cline 插件(在扩展市场搜索 "Cline" 安装)
- 已注册 OpenStarry 账号并获取 API Key
Step 1:打开 Cline 设置
在 VS Code 中,点击侧边栏的 Cline 图标,或使用快捷键 Cmd+Shift+P(Mac)/ Ctrl+Shift+P(Windows/Linux),输入 "Cline: Open Settings" 打开设置面板。
Step 2:选择 API Provider
在设置面板中,找到 API Provider 下拉框,选择 "OpenAI Compatible"。这是接入第三方 API 的通用选项。
Step 3:填写 API 配置
| 配置项 | 值 |
|---|---|
| Base URL | https://api.openstarry.com/v1 |
| API Key | sk-your-key-here |
| Model ID | claude-sonnet-4-6(推荐默认模型) |
Step 4:验证连接
配置完成后,在 Cline 对话框中输入一个简单问题,比如"你好,请介绍一下你自己"。如果能在 1-2 秒内收到回复,说明配置成功。
Step 5:配置智能路由(可选)
如果你想启用智能模型路由来降低成本,可以在 Cline 设置中配置多个模型:
{
"cline.modelRouting": {
"simple": "deepseek-v4-flash",
"moderate": "kimi-k2.6",
"complex": "claude-sonnet-4-6"
}
}
这样,Cline 会根据任务复杂度自动切换模型。简单的文件操作和格式调整使用 DeepSeek V4-Flash(成本极低),中等复杂度的代码编写使用 Kimi K2.6(性价比高),复杂的架构设计和调试使用 Claude Sonnet(能力最强)。
推荐模型搭配方案
通过 OpenStarry 接入 Cline 后,你可以自由选择不同模型来适配不同场景。以下是我们推荐的搭配方案:
| 场景 | 推荐模型 | 原因 | 参考成本 |
|---|---|---|---|
| 简单代码补全 | DeepSeek V4-Flash | 速度快,成本极低 | $0.10/M tokens |
| 日常代码编写 | Kimi K2.6 | 代码能力强,性价比高 | $2.50/M tokens |
| 复杂代码重构 | Claude Sonnet 4.6 | 推理能力强,理解上下文精准 | $9/M tokens |
| 架构设计 | Claude Opus 4.6 | 最强综合能力 | $45/M tokens |
实际成本估算
以一个中等活跃度的开发者为例(每天使用 Cline 2-3 小时):
- 全程 Claude Sonnet:约 $40-60/月
- 智能路由(推荐):约 $8-12/月
- 全程 DeepSeek V4-Flash:约 $2-4/月
智能路由方案在成本和效果之间取得了最佳平衡,是我们推荐大多数开发者使用的方案。
成本优化技巧
1. 善用 .clineignore 文件
在项目根目录创建 .clineignore 文件,排除不需要 AI 分析的目录(如 node_modules、dist、.git)。这可以显著减少上下文 token 消耗。
# .clineignore
node_modules/
dist/
build/
.git/
*.lock
*.min.js
2. 合理设置上下文窗口
Cline 默认会读取较大范围的项目文件作为上下文。如果你的项目很大,建议在设置中限制上下文窗口大小,只包含当前工作相关的文件。
3. 使用 OpenStarry 的语义缓存
OpenStarry 提供语义缓存功能。当你发送与之前相似的请求时(比如对同一段代码反复提问),系统会自动命中缓存,节省 30-50% 的 token 费用,同时响应速度更快。
4. 批量操作时选择便宜模型
在执行批量文件重命名、格式化、添加注释等简单操作时,手动切换到 DeepSeek V4-Flash。这些任务不需要强大的推理能力,便宜模型就能很好地完成。
5. 设置月度预算告警
在 OpenStarry Dashboard 中,你可以设置月度预算上限和告警阈值。当 API 费用达到预设值时,系统会通过邮件通知你,避免意外的高额账单。
常见问题
Q:配置后 Cline 无法连接怎么办?
首先检查 Base URL 是否正确填写为 https://api.openstarry.com/v1(注意末尾有 /v1)。其次确认 API Key 格式为 sk- 开头。如果仍有问题,可以在浏览器中直接访问 https://api.openstarry.com/v1/models 确认 API 是否可达。
Q:Cline 支持哪些模型?
通过 OpenAI Compatible 方式接入后,Cline 支持 OpenStarry 平台上的所有模型,包括 Claude 全系列、GPT 全系列、DeepSeek、Kimi、GLM 等 40+ 模型。
Q:Cline 和 GitHub Copilot 可以同时使用吗?
可以。Cline 和 GitHub Copilot 的功能定位不同。Copilot 侧重于行级代码补全,Cline 侧重于任务级的自主编码。两者可以互补使用。
Q:Cline 会上传我的代码到第三方吗?
Cline 只会将你当前对话上下文中的代码片段发送到 API 提供商。通过 OpenStarry 转发时,OpenStarry 默认不存储任何请求内容,仅记录计费元数据。
写在最后
Cline 是目前 VS Code 生态中最强大的 AI 编程助手之一。通过接入 OpenStarry 的第三方 API,国内开发者可以获得低延迟、低成本、多模型选择的编程体验。
配合智能模型路由和语义缓存,你的月度 API 费用可以控制在 $8-12 的范围内,却能享受到从 DeepSeek 到 Claude 全系列模型的能力。这可能是目前性价比最高的 AI 编程方案。